About 23a
23a is a two-bedroom end-of-terrace house in Brighton (BN2 5TG). It has a recorded floor area of 49 m² (around 527 sq ft), construction records dating it to before 1900 and council tax band B. Tenure is freehold. The latest certificate (August 2014) shows a D (score 64), on the cusp of jumping into the C band. When first surveyed in April 2011 the rating was E, the property has climbed 1 band since. Between certificates, roof efficiency dropped from Good to Average. The recommended improvements would push it to C (score 77). The latest certificate is from August 2014, so improvements made since then won't be reflected. At 49 m² this is the 13th smallest of 37 units on EPC record in the building, where floor areas span 33–175 m². The building's EPC ratings span E to C across 37 units on file.
At 49 m² it sits well below the postcode median (74 m² across 36 EPCs), making it one of the more compact homes locally. 2 planning records sit against the property, 1 approved, 1 refused. Past consents include a loft conversion, meaningful when judging how the property has evolved. Across 2007–2022, sale prices on this property compounded at 3.4% per year. On a £-per-square-foot basis, the last sale (£616/sq ft) was about 168.7% above the typical sold price in the postcode. Sold March 2022 for £325,000. That sale was during the post-pandemic price surge, when transactions cleared materially above pre-2020 trend.
